Understanding the GTX 1080’s Specifications

Before we dive into the resolution capabilities of the GTX 1080, let’s take a look at its specifications. The GTX 1080 is based on the Pascal architecture and features 2560 CUDA cores, 160 texture mapping units, and 64 render outputs. It also has 8 GB of GDDR5X memory, which provides a memory bandwidth of 320 GB/s. The GTX 1080 has a base clock speed of 1506 MHz and a boost clock speed of 1733 MHz.

Memory Interface

The GTX 1080 has a 256-bit memory interface, which is relatively wide compared to other graphics cards in its class. This wide memory interface allows for faster data transfer and helps to reduce memory bottlenecks.

Resolution Capabilities

So, what resolution can the GTX 1080 run? The answer depends on several factors, including the game or application being used, the level of detail, and the refresh rate. However, here are some general guidelines on what you can expect from the GTX 1080 in terms of resolution:

1080p (1920×1080)

The GTX 1080 can easily handle 1080p resolutions with high frame rates. In fact, it can handle 1080p at 144 Hz or even 240 Hz with some games. This makes it an excellent choice for fast-paced games that require quick reflexes.

Performance at 1080p

In terms of performance, the GTX 1080 can deliver frame rates of over 100 FPS in many modern games at 1080p. This includes games like Fortnite, League of Legends, and Overwatch.

1440p (2560×1440)

The GTX 1080 can also handle 1440p resolutions with ease. In fact, it can deliver frame rates of over 60 FPS in many modern games at 1440p. This makes it an excellent choice for gamers who want to play at high resolutions without sacrificing performance.

4K (3840×2160)

The GTX 1080 can also handle 4K resolutions, but it may struggle to deliver high frame rates. In fact, it can deliver frame rates of around 30-40 FPS in many modern games at 4K. This makes it less suitable for gamers who want to play at 4K resolutions with high frame rates.

What are the key features of the NVIDIA GeForce GTX 1080?

The NVIDIA GeForce GTX 1080 boasts several key features that make it an attractive option for gamers and professionals. Some of the notable features include support for DirectX 12, Vulkan, and NVIDIA’s proprietary technologies like SMP and VRS. The GTX 1080 also features NVIDIA’s GPU Boost 3.0 technology, which allows for dynamic clock speed adjustments to optimize performance and power consumption.

Additionally, the GTX 1080 supports NVIDIA’s G-Sync technology, which eliminates screen tearing and provides a smoother gaming experience. The GPU also features 2560 CUDA cores, 8 GB of GDDR5X memory, and a 256-bit memory bus, making it well-suited for demanding applications like 4K gaming, video editing, and 3D modeling.

What are the power consumption and noise levels of the NVIDIA GeForce GTX 1080?

The NVIDIA GeForce GTX 1080 has a typical board power (TBP) of 180 watts, which is relatively high compared to modern GPUs. However, the GTX 1080 is designed to provide high performance, and its power consumption is still relatively efficient compared to its predecessors. In terms of noise levels, the GTX 1080 is generally quiet, with a noise level of around 40 dBA under load.

However, the noise level can vary depending on the specific GPU model and cooling system. Some custom-cooled GTX 1080 models can be much quieter, while others may be louder.
